The Cohen Center for Kansas History

Located in the southeast alcove of the Learning Resource Center on 91³Ô¹Ï꿉۪s main campus, the Cohen Center for Kansas History is a unique resource dedicated to preserving Kansas history and encouraging student and faculty research. The Center was established through the generosity of 91³Ô¹ÏÍø P. and Dr. Mary Davidson Cohen of Leawood, Kansas.

Students Preparing to Transfer
Students Preparing to Transfer

91³Ô¹ÏÍø's history curriculum is designed to provide the general education requirement and core history courses for students who plan to transfer to a four-year college or university to complete a bachelor's degree in history. In addition to general education courses in American History, we offer a variety of electives including Western Civilizations, Kansas History and Military histories. Electives must meet the requirements of your transferring institution. Students should coordinate with their advisor for transfer requirements.
